WebJun 17, 2024 · The world produces about 180 million metric tons of ammonia every year, over 80 percent of which goes to fertilizer production. Nearly all this ammonia is made using an energy-hungry technique called the Haber–Bosch process, which reacts hydrogen and atmospheric nitrogen. WebFeb 22, 2024 · Haber and Bosch were both awarded Nobel prizes for their work. More than a century later, the Haber-Bosch process is still used to make the ammonia for most fertilizers and thus helps feed billions of people around the world today. Right now, about 90% of all ammonia produced worldwide is used in fertilizer. WebAug 23, 2024 · Nitrogen molecules are separated from the air we breathe and hydrogen is generally derived from either natural gas or coal in a process which creates greenhouse gasses or about 1.8% of CO2 emissions worldwide 2. Once you have the nitrogen & hydrogen segregated, the Haber-Bosch process is employed to make ammonia. crear mosaico online gratis
